Protein Content Goals

Choosing the right protein content in your powder is essential for supporting weight loss goals. I recommend aiming for at least 20-30 grams of protein per serving, as this helps you feel full longer and preserves muscle mass during calorie deficits. Higher protein intake also boosts thermogenesis, meaning you’ll burn more calories throughout the day. It’s important to take into account your overall daily protein needs, which depend on your body weight, activity level, and goals. Spreading protein intake across meals can improve appetite control and prevent overeating. Staying mindful of your total protein intake ensures you’re fueling your body effectively without overdoing it. Focus on hitting these protein targets consistently to maximize fat loss while maintaining energy and muscle.

Fiber Benefits

Incorporating fiber-rich protein powders can substantially boost your weight loss efforts by increasing feelings of fullness and reducing overall calorie intake. When a protein powder contains 7 grams or more of fiber per serving, it can support digestive health and promote regularity, making it easier to stick with your diet. The prebiotic fiber in some options nourishes beneficial gut bacteria, improving your gut microbiome balance, which is linked to better weight management. Higher fiber content also slows digestion, leading to sustained energy levels and fewer hunger pangs throughout the day. By choosing a protein powder with ample fiber, you can enhance satiety, support healthy digestion, and make your weight loss journey more effective. Are There Any Allergens Common in These Protein Powders?

Yes, some common allergens can be found in protein powders, like dairy, soy, or nuts. I always check labels carefully because if you’re allergic, even a small amount can cause issues. For example, whey and casein are dairy-based, while soy protein is a common allergen. If you have allergies, look for allergen-free or plant-based options to keep your workouts safe and effective.

How Do Protein Powders Affect Overall Calorie Intake?

I’ve found that protein powders can either increase or help control your calorie intake, depending on how you use them. If I replace a high-calorie meal with a protein shake, I cut calories and support weight loss. But if I add powders on top of my regular meals, I might end up consuming more calories. It’s all about mindful use and balancing your overall diet to stay on track.

Do Flavored Protein Powders Contain Added Sugars?

Yes, flavored protein powders often contain added sugars to improve taste, which can add extra calories. I always check the nutrition label before buying; some brands use artificial sweeteners instead of sugar, making them lower in calories. If you’re watching your sugar intake, opt for unsweetened or naturally flavored options. That way, you get the protein boost without risking extra sugar or calories that could hinder weight loss.
